With Just Hours To Go, Obama Suddenly In A Negotiating Mood

Submitted by Tyler Durden on 09/30/2013 - 12:58Last week Obama was unwilling to negotiate on the two key issues in the current government pre-shutdown debacle: Obamacare and the debt ceiling. Things seem to have changed quite quickly, now that the government shutdown is just 11 hours away.

  • OBAMA SAYS EVERYONE MUST SIT DOWN AND NEGOTIATE IN GOOD FAITH, CAN'T HAVE TALKS UNDER RISK OF POTENTIAL U.S. DEBT DEFAULT
  • OBAMA SAYS HE IS NOT RESIGNED TO A GOVERNMENT SHUTDOWN TAKING PLACE
  • OBAMA SAYS U.S. DOLLAR IS RESERVE CURRENCY OF THE WORLD, "WE DON'T MESS WITH THAT
  • OBAMA SAYS EXPECTS TO SPEAK TO CONGRESSIONAL LEADERS MONDAY, TUESDAY, WEDNESDAY
